E E 422: Communication Systems II
(3-0) Cr. 3.
Prereq: E E 321; E E 322; enrollment in E E 423
Introduction to probability and random processes; Performance of analog systems with noise; Performance of digital communication with noise; optimum receivers, transmission impairments, and error rates; Introduction to information theory and coding: source coding, channel coding, channel capacity.
AER E 422: Vibrations and Aeroelasticity
(3-0) Cr. 3. Alt. S., offered even-numbered years.
Prereq: AER E 321 or E M 324
Vibration theory. Steady and unsteady flows. Mathematical foundations of aeroelasticity, static and dynamic aeroelasticity. Linear unsteady aerodynamics, non-steady aerodynamics of lifting surfaces. Stall flutter. Aeroelastic problems in civil engineering structures. Aeroelastic problems of rotorcraft. Experimental aeroelasticity. Selected wind tunnel laboratory experiments.
CON E 422: Construction Cost Estimating and Cost Engineering
(2-2) Cr. 3. F.S.
Prereq: CON E 241; CON E 251
Conceptual and detailed cost estimating. Theory and practice of estimating construction costs of materials, labor, equipment, contingency, overhead and markup. Estimating competencies and bid ethics. Electronic quantity take off and pricing methods. Assemblies costs, unit costs, production rates. Analysis of project profitability, cost analysis and cost control methods. Value engineering. Life cycle cost analysis.
S E 422: Cloud Computing - Software Development
(3-0) Cr. 3. F.
Prereq: (S E 309 or S E 339); (CPR E 381 or COM S 321)
A comprehensive view of cloud computing with respect to software development from platforms and services to programming and infrastructure. Virtualization and containerization; cloud computing platforms, with examples from currently available cloud services; cloud services for data analytics, machine learning, and devops; programming frameworks for parallel computing in the cloud; distributed storage in the cloud; Container management. Includes homeworks and programming assignments. The programming assignments will be done in AWS.
